Motion Dashboard
The Motion Dashboard puts many operations at your fingertips for
convenient access and control. To open the Motion Dashboard, press the
Motion Dashboard button. The Motion Dashboard can be viewed in the
Category View or the Classic View. While the settings are the same in either
view, the Category View conserves space on the screen.

NOTE: Hibernate mode attempts to save data in any open programs to your
hard disk drive. When you restart the Tablet PC, it should return to the same
system status as before hibernation.
